Question : The concept of "deterritorialization" in globalisation refers to:
Option 1: Strengthening of territorial borders
Option 2: Reduction of global trade
Option 3: Weakening of the link between culture and place
Option 4: Decrease in international communication
Correct Answer: Weakening of the link between culture and place
Solution : The concept of "deterritorialization" in globalisation refers to the weakening of the link between culture and place, as cultural practices and ideas can spread and be adopted globally, independent of their geographical origins.
